• Former FDNY, Bayville Firefighter's 9/11 Legacy Lives On Through Family (patch.com) — Bayville residents are honoring the 9/11 legacy of former Bayville firefighter and FDNY member Eddie Doyle through a growing family team that walks annually in the Tunnel to Towers event. His brother John describes how their tight-knit Long Island family, local fire service, and community rallied around them, and how donations in Eddie's name now support youth wrestling and students in need.

• Toddler Sports Program for Fall (jericho-news-journal.com) — Families in the Town of Oyster Bay can now register their 3- and 4-year-olds for the fall Toddler Sports Program at the Hicksville Athletic Center, starting September 29. The six-week program costs $75 for resident children, offers weekday morning classes, and requires proof of residency and age, with limited spots available through the town's online Parks Registration Portal.

• Plainview residents fight planned removal of trees damaging sidewalks (news12.com) — Plainview homeowners in the Town of Oyster Bay are protesting the planned removal of mature trees whose roots have damaged nearby sidewalks, fearing the neighborhood will lose valued shade and character. The town cites pedestrian safety and says sidewalks must be repaired at homeowners' expense, and typically does not replant trees after removal, though residents may plant their own replacements.
